基于Bluetooth和TOA定位算法的圖書館導航系統
近年來,隨著無線技術和移動通信的飛速發展,以及Bluetooth,Wifi,GPRS等無線技術的日趨成熟,同時,各種無線定位技術的出現,極大的方便了生活,推進了社會的發展。藍牙技術(Bluetooth)作為一種短距離無線通訊技術,其實質內容是為固定設備或移動設備之間的通信環境建立通用的無線電空中接口(Radio AirInterface),將通信技術與計算機技術進一步結合起來,使各種3C設備在沒有電線或電纜相互連接的情況下,能在近距離范圍內實現相互通信或操作,實現數據共享。利用藍牙設備近距離范圍內相互通信的特性,結合TOA算法,并全面考慮實際應用中信號衰減、障礙物阻隔等情況,就可以實現較為精準的藍牙定位系統,再進一步結合Web、數據庫等后臺支持,可以開發一套圖書館藍牙自動導航系統,以實現移動終端書籍自助查詢與導航功能。
本文引用地址:http://www.j9360.com/article/152509.htm1 系統結構及功能
圖書館書籍定位系統由三部分組成:安裝在用戶手機上的定位軟件(客戶端),后臺服務器以及分布在圖書館里的藍牙信號發射點,如圖1所示。
客戶端實現了用戶在手持設備無線查詢書籍以及用戶的定位導航功能。用戶首次登錄軟件后,軟件通過無線網絡自動從后臺數據庫下載地形和藍牙點分布的XML文件,并根據文件描述繪制出圖書館地形圖。之后用戶可以在書籍查詢界面以書名,作者,ISBN方式模糊查詢所需要的書籍。用戶選擇書籍后,軟件將所選書籍的位置標注在地圖上,同時開啟藍牙,檢測周邊藍牙信號點信號強度并進行定位。定位成功后軟件自動計算用戶從當前位置到書籍位置的最佳路徑,并標注在地圖上。同時,在用戶找書的過程中,系統會實時測量用戶所在位置,實時更新最佳路徑,引導用戶找到所需書籍。
后臺服務器儲存書籍詳細信息、圖書館地形圖以及各個藍牙信號發射點分布情況。并及時響應用戶的不同請求。
藍牙信號發射點分布在整個圖書館內,信號范圍覆蓋整個圖書館,每個藍牙信號發射點有自己惟一的ID標識號,當用戶定位時通過標識號即可從配置文件中知道此藍牙信號發射點的位置。
通過三個子系統的分工合作,系統實現了查詢定位導航一體化的高效圖書查詢功能。

評論